Aug 5, 2020There are definitely some glaring issues though with lots of buggy NPC's and game textures plus it has probably one of the worst in-game camera systems I've ever seen. It's like playing a PS3 game with 4k graphics. The story was pretty good though, I think that was probably what drove me to actually play through it. Decent game overall but certainly has a ton of issues.

Jul 18, 2020This game is good, but not the best, it would’ve been a lot better if they made the AI in-story a little bet better and not like a complete bot. Visually, it’s very good the graphics are amazing, gameplay and combat and sword mechanics are also very good, the story is just ok. I only had a problem with the stupid AI it felt like a 2006 ps3 game’s AI lol, but worth a playthrough tho.

Sep 15, 2020Ultimately, it feels like the game could have benefited from a smaller scope or a more linear structure. Focus on the duels could have created a more engrossing product, especially if it honed in on the narrative for a more concise and cinematic experience. But as it stands, Ghost of Tsushima is another AAA open world title and doesn’t seek to define itself as anything other than that.
